Abstract

ABSTRACT - Jute fiber reinforced low density polyethylene LDPE composites and glass fiber reinforced LDPE composites were prepared at variable proportions using compression molding technique at 120 C. Few physical and mechanical properties such as bulk density water absorption tensile strength elongation at break Eb Youngs modulus flexural stress and strain and tangent modulus of both composites were studied and compared. Throughout the study it was revealed that glass composites had better mechanical stability as compared to LDPE jute composites.
